Fees and Cost Over Time
DRVR charges 0.39% per year while VYM charges 0.04%. On a $10,000 position that is $39 vs $4 annually, a gap of $35 per year that compounds over a long holding period. On income, DRVR currently yields 0.10% against 2.24% for VYM.
Holdings Overlap
89.3% of DRVR's money is in holdings VYM also owns. 15.8% of VYM's money is in holdings DRVR also owns.
Most of DRVR is already inside VYM. Owning both mostly buys the same companies twice.
37 positions in common, counted across the 50 positions we hold weights for in DRVR and 603 in VYM, against full books of 51 and 613.
What only one of them owns
Our book lists 534 positions for VYM that do not appear in our book for DRVR (82.0% of the fund), and 13 for DRVR that do not appear in VYM (10.6%).
Some of those will be the same company recorded under a different code in one of the two books, so the real difference in what you would own is no larger than this and may be smaller. We do not name the individual positions here for that reason.
